OPENOFFISE ODF Presentation to WEBP conversion is the process of extracting slide visuals from an ODP (OpenDocument Presentation) file and encoding them as WEBP images. This converts each slide or selected slide export into the modern, efficient WEBP raster format for use on the web, in documents, or for sharing.

The MIME type for ODP files is application/vnd.oasis.opendocument.presentation, mainly used for editable presentation documents. WEBP files use the image/webp MIME type and employ advanced codecs like VP8 and VP9, providing lossy and lossless compression. WEBP is widely supported by modern browsers and used to deliver high-quality images with reduced bandwidth consumption.

OPENOFFISE ODF Presentation (ODP) files are primarily designed for editable multi-slide presentations, containing text, graphics, and multimedia elements. In contrast, WEBP is a modern image format focused on optimized compression for web images, offering smaller file sizes and faster loading times. While ODP files are suited for presentations, WEBP is ideal for sharing individual slides or images extracted from those presentations online.
Keep individual exported WEBP images below 1–2 MB for fast web delivery; aim for 70–85 quality for good visual fidelity with smaller sizes.
Preserve text sharpness by exporting at higher resolution (or as vector where supported) before converting to WEBP; use lossless WEBP if text legibility is critical.
For many slides, use batch conversion to maintain consistent quality and naming; convert during off-peak hours if CPU-intensive compression is chosen.
Limitations: animated slide transitions and embedded multimedia (audio/video) in ODP are not preserved in static WEBP images — only visual frames are exported.
